A common tactic used by malicious actors on these platforms is forcing the user to download a custom "codec" or "special media player" to view the x265 file. Legitimate x265 files are standard .mkv or .mp4 containers that play natively on trusted players like VLC, MPC-HC, or PotPlayer.
